For example. Happy – happily; Angry – angrily; Usage of adverbs of manner. Only the definition would not suffice. Let us try to understand what are the rules regarding their usage. Adverbs of manner are words that are never placed in between a verb and the object. They are usually placed either before the main verb or at the end of a sentence.

When such an adverb modifies an action by describing how that particular action happens, it is said to be an adverb of manner. In simple words, adverbs of manner are basically the type of adverb that helps us change or modify a verb by indicating how something happens. Or we can say they describe the way a particular thing takes place in a sentence. If you are still confused, try to figure out the examples given below. The man was eating slowly. He was happily leaving the class. She ran quickly.

Adverbs of manner help us to express how we do something. Most adverbs of manner end with ‘-ly’ and they can express the speed, volume, or style with which we do things. Some common examples of adverbs of manner are: quickly, slowly, loudly, quietly, beautifully and badly.

Remember! An adverb of manner cannot be put between a verb and its direct object. For example, it is incorrect to say: Daisy ate slowly the pizza. 1. Modal verbs and phrasal verbs. With modal verbs, the adverb of manner appears after the main verb or after the object:. Subject + modal + main verb + adverb of manner e.g. You mustn’t shout loudly in the corridor.
